    Rogers does have a plan for $ 50 or so and all incoming and outgoing calls are unlimited, If you are in Canada and making calls to US that also is unlimited but if you use it In states then its something like 1.45 a min. But all SMS's to and from states are included unlimited. No caller ID and voice mail though if you want one then u will pay like 15 dollars add on for both of them.

    Another option if you are running the states is get your phone unlocked and then get a sim card from a US company. We use verizon but that is because we can each get unlimited for around 90 total a month with them. I was in Pearson the other day and saw two guys switching out their bell cards for t mobile cards before they got on the plane. Yup the way to go. I had the Verizon Canada plan but really it was not worth it since I am barely in Canada when for the same price I get unlimited in the US.
